Overview
The SN65CML100DGKRG4 is a high-speed, mixed signal translator integrated circuit (IC) manufactured by Texas Instruments. This device is designed to convert single-ended LVDS (Low Voltage Differential Signaling) or LVPECL (Low Voltage Positive Emitter-Coupled Logic) signals to differential CML (Current Mode Logic) signals. It operates at a data rate of up to 1.5 Gbps, making it suitable for high-speed digital systems such as telecommunications and data storage applications. The IC features a compact 8-VSSOP package and low power consumption, making it an ideal solution for space-constrained designs.
Key Specifications
Parameter | Value |
---|---|
Mfr | Texas Instruments |
Series | 65CML |
Translator Type | Mixed Signal |
Channel Type | Unidirectional |
Number of Circuits | 1 |
Channels per Circuit | 1 |
Input Signal | CML, LVDS, LVPECL |
Output Signal | CML |
Output Type | Differential |
Data Rate | 1.5 Gbps |
Operating Temperature | -40°C ~ 85°C (TA) |
Mounting Type | Surface Mount |
Package / Case | 8-VSSOP, 8-MSOP (0.118", 3.00mm Width) |
